Inter Milan 4-3 Barcelona (Agg: 7-6): Davide Frattesi’s winner decides Champions League semi-final thriller as Inter book final spot – Sky Sports New

Powered by WPeMatico

More News

BREAKING NEWS | India launches missile strikes on Pakistan – IOL

WATCH: South Africa thrash Sierra Leone to boost World Cup hopes ahead of Southern African Derby clash at Afcon – Goal.com